Chongqing, Nuevo León Forge Strong Sister City Bond | Sister Cities

By YAN DENG|Apr 20,2024

Chongqing - In recent years, Chongqing has seized the opportunity to accelerate building the city into a Hub for International Exchanges in Central and Western China, continuously integrating and expanding foreign affairs resources.

The city has increased efforts to invite foreign entities and expand its presence globally. As a result, Chongqing's international network has grown, fostering broader exchanges with sister cities, solidifying partnerships, and paving the way for a wider path of friendship.

Chongqing and Nuevo León, a state in Mexico, were established as sister cities on November 12, 2013. Since then, their partnership has flourished, spanning various sectors, including local governance, trade, and smart manufacturing.

The city view of Nuevo León. (Photo/Foreign Affairs Office of Chongqing Municipal People's Government)

Located in northeastern Mexico, bordering the US state of Texas, Nuevo León is known for its robust steel, glass, and automotive parts industries. The state places a high emphasis on infrastructure development and education, with the Autonomous University of Nuevo León standing as one of Mexico's foremost public universities, boasting a Confucius Institute among its offerings.

The Mexican company Nemak invested in Chongqing, primarily producing aluminum cylinder heads, engine blocks, and automobile suspension system components. In June 2012, it settled in the Yufu Industrial Park in the Liangjiang New Area, primarily supporting Chang'an Ford.

In December 2019, the Chongqing Council for the Promotion of International Trade organized over ten companies to participate in a business matchmaking event in Mexico, signaling the commitment to enhance bilateral economic cooperation.

Amidst the outbreak of the COVID-19 pandemic, Nuevo León and Chongqing reciprocally assisted each other by recommending channels for procuring medical supplies and vaccines.

In July 2021, representatives from Chongqing and Nuevo León jointly participated in a Sino-Mexican local government economic and trade exchange video conference organized by the China People's Association for Friendship with Foreign Countries and the Association of Economic Development Secretaries of Mexican States.

In October 2023, representatives from Chongqing Municipal Education Commission, Foreign Affairs Office of Chongqing Municipal People's Government, Chongqing Industrial Vocational College, and delegates from Chang'an Automotive held discussions with the Governor of Nuevo León in Beijing.
